Qutub Minar And Complex Travel Guide

Located in Delhi, India, the Qutub Minar and Complex is a UNESCO World Heritage Site that holds significant historical and cultural importance. The complex dates back to the early 13th century and showcases exquisite Afghan architecture, reflecting the rich history of the region. The main attraction, the Qutub Minar, is a towering minaret that stands at 73 meters high, making it the tallest brick minaret in the world. This destination is famous for its intricate carvings, ancient ruins, and stunning architecture that attract history buffs and architecture enthusiasts from around the globe.

Important Qutub Minar And Complex trip information

  • Ideal Duration: A half-day visit is sufficient to explore the complex.
  • Best Time to Visit: The winter months from October to March offer pleasant weather.
  • Nearby Airports and Railway Stations: The Indira Gandhi International Airport is the nearest airport, and the New Delhi Railway Station is the closest railway station.
